Carry limit: Each power has what is known as a "carry limit", or how well the user can control it and what they are capable of doing with it. Each power on its own is practically unlimited in the scope and scale of its use, but are burdened with the experience of the user, or the toll placed on the body and mind by using it. These limit what a power-user can do. So even if you have a weak power, if you have a high carry limit, you can be potentially more powerful than someone with a strong power but a low carry limit.

To determine carry limit, roll a six-sided die six times, then average the results and round.

1 - Low: The person has little to no control over their powers

2 - Mid: The person can exert some control over their powers

3 - High: The person can adequately use their powers, typically represents a rise from " human" to "superbeing"

4 - Very High: The person can excellently control their powers, typically people of this rank are considered fairly to very powerful

5 - Extremely High: The person has almost complete control over their powers, and can use them to a degree where limitations become negligible

6 - Godlike: The person has complete control and unlimited use of their powers without restrictions. Typically referred to as "hax"
